δια-κρι^τέον ,
A.one must decide, D.L.9.92: pl. “-έαTh.1.86.
2. one must distinguish, Dsc.5.106, Porph.Abst.2.50, Iamb.Myst.2.2: Adj. -κριτέος, α, ον, to be distinguished, Philostr.Gym.33.
3. one must separate, Sor.2.89.
